Enhancing Operational Resilience Through Digital Integration

Operational resilience has become a critical focus for financial institutions as regulatory requirements tighten and market volatility increases. Achieving resilience requires more than just traditional risk management strategies; it calls for the seamless integration of digital solutions that reduce manual processes, improve efficiency, and enhance response times during disruptions.

The Role of Digital Integration in Securities Finance

Digital integration is the key to building resilient securities finance operations. By streamlining data flows and automating workflows, institutions can mitigate operational risks and reduce their reliance on manual processes, which are prone to errors and inefficiencies.

API connectivity plays a crucial role here, allowing different systems and platforms to communicate effortlessly. This real-time exchange of information ensures that trade, collateral, and cash flow data are consistent across all systems, reducing operational friction and enhancing the ability to manage risks dynamically.

Benefits of Digital Integration for Operational Resilience

  1. Reduced Operational Risk: Manual processes are often the weak link in operational resilience, as they are more susceptible to human error. Automating these tasks, such as trade reconciliation and lifecycle event management, minimises the potential for mistakes and accelerates responses to market events.
  2. Enhanced Flexibility: API-driven integration allows institutions to adjust their workflows in response to changes in the market or regulatory environment. Whether adding new counterparties or adapting to shifts in liquidity needs, digital integration provides the agility needed to maintain resilience in dynamic conditions.
  3. Improved Data Accuracy and Consistency: By integrating systems and automating data exchanges, institutions ensure that data is accurate and up to date. This consistency across all platforms is crucial for managing both front- and back-office functions, enabling faster decision-making and reducing discrepancies between counterparties.
  4. Scalability: Institutions can scale their operations more easily when they have a fully integrated digital infrastructure. This scalability is particularly important for institutions managing large volumes of trades and collateral across multiple asset classes, ensuring that they can handle increased demands without compromising operational efficiency.

Bridging Legacy Systems with Modern Solutions

For many institutions, the challenge lies in bridging legacy systems with modern digital solutions. The key to overcoming this barrier is, naturally, API integration, which enables legacy systems to communicate with new platforms. This approach allows institutions to gradually enhance their digital capabilities without the need for a complete overhaul of their infrastructure.

Cloud-based solutions offer flexibility and scalability, providing institutions with the ability to adjust their technology stack according to market demands while maintaining robust security and compliance standards.

Challenges and Considerations

While digital integration offers clear benefits, there are important considerations to bear in mind:

  • Data Security: As systems become more interconnected, ensuring the security of sensitive financial data becomes even more critical. Institutions must implement robust cybersecurity measures to protect against data breaches and cyberattacks.
  • Compliance: Integrating digital solutions must align with regulatory requirements, which vary across jurisdictions. Institutions need to ensure that any new integrations support compliance efforts, particularly around data reporting and transparency.
